VPS需要安装哪些运行库?_常见运行库清单与安装指南

VPS需要安装哪些运行库?

运行库类型 示例 用途说明
编译工具 gcc, make 用于编译源代码
编程语言环境 python, nodejs 运行特定语言编写的程序
数据库支持 mysql-client, postgresql 数据库连接与操作
网络工具 curl, wget 网络请求与文件下载
系统工具 vim, nano 文本编辑与管理

VPS运行库安装指南

常见运行库清单

根据不同的使用场景,VPS通常需要安装以下类型的运行库:
  1. 编译工具:如gcc、make等,用于编译和构建软件
  2. 编程语言环境:如Python、Node.js、Ruby等运行时环境
  3. 数据库支持:如MySQL客户端、PostgreSQL等数据库连接库
  4. 网络工具:如curl、wget等网络请求工具
  5. 系统工具:如vim、nano等文本编辑器

安装步骤详解

1. 更新系统包管理器

sudo apt-get update  # Debian/Ubuntu系统
sudo yum update     # CentOS/RHEL系统

2. 安装基本编译工具

sudo apt-get install build-essential  # Debian/Ubuntu
sudo yum groupinstall "Development Tools"  # CentOS

3. 安装特定语言环境

# 安装Python3
sudo apt-get install python3 python3-pip

安装Node.js

curl -fsSL https://deb.nodesource.com/setup_14.x | sudo -E bash - sudo apt-get install -y nodejs

4. 安装数据库客户端

# MySQL客户端
sudo apt-get install mysql-client

PostgreSQL客户端

sudo apt-get install postgresql-client

常见问题与解决方案

问题现象 可能原因 解决方案
安装失败提示依赖缺失 未先更新包管理器 先执行sudo apt-get update
命令找不到 未正确安装或未加入PATH 检查安装并确认PATH设置
版本不兼容 安装的版本与系统不匹配 指定适合系统的版本号安装
权限不足 未使用sudo或用户无权限 使用sudo或以root用户执行

发表评论

评论列表